Daniel Protheroe

Daniel Protheroe (5 November 1866 – 25 February 1934), was a Welsh composer and conductor, born at Cwmgiedd, Brecknockshire. After success at the National Eisteddfod at a young age, he immigrated to the US, where he was educated. He is best known for composing Calvinist Methodist hymns.

Birth and Death Data: Born November 5, 1866 (Ystradgynlais), Died February 25, 1934 (Chicago)

Date Range of DAHR Recordings: 1911 - 1931

Roles Represented in DAHR: composer, choral director, piano, arranger
